    Sagebrush Trails & Services has ten years experience in the trail industry. I started by subcontracting for an independent trail contractor building trails for two years, then I began working with the local recreation district as the Trail Maintenance Coordinator and have been there for over eight years. In 2006 I received a phone call and was asked if I could build a trail and in 2007 I started building trails on the side and then started my business. In these ten years I have been involved with building approximately 60 miles of natural and soft surface trails and am currently managing and maintaining over 120 miles of natural, soft, hard surface, and XC ski trails.
